| Under Construction | hi every one my aim to become fit and gain decent muscle size and definition. if i train to much cardio will i not achieve as good muscle gains and if i do too much weights i will not be able to become as fit . how many times of of each types of work outs do you recomend so they both become balanced i was thinking of just using my weights at home every three days and doing cardio three times a week for around an hour. thanks every one |

| Making Progress Join Date: Sep 2004 Location: Southampton Posts: 343 Rep Power: ![]() | You do need a balance between the two otherwise too much cardio will catabolise the muscle. 3 days of each is fine but cut the cardio to 30 mins max, and vary the intensity from sesson to session. Also for muscle groth you must allow for the fact that you will need extra calories for the weight training and especially the cardio. About 500-700 calories per day more than you are consuming now. Aim for 6-10 reps in the weight training, starting with a whole body workout each session, ie legs, back chest shoulders and arms giving each bodypart 3-4 sets to begin with. | Join Date: Dec 2003 Posts: 0 Rep Power: ![]() | i agree, but make sure you don't do what i did and interpret the 'cardio to a minimum' as a 5 min warm-up on the treadmill and nothing more! i slacked on cardio big time over the last few months and payed the price in fat gain, lost half a stone of fat while cutting 4-5 months back and now i'm back where i started again because i cut all my cardio out in an attempt to pack on muscle cardio is very important, 2 sessions a week minimum at no longer than 20mins should be fine, this won't interfere with muscle gains peace |
